Heat treatment for bed bugs is an environmentally friendly, chemical-free solution that utilizes controlled heats to get rid of all life phases of bed bugs, consisting of eggs. The process involves raising the temperature of infested spaces or structures to levels lethal to bed bugs, generally in between 120 ° F and 140 ° F, for a number of hours. Heat penetrates furnishings, walls, and mattresses, removing pests in hard-to-reach locations. This treatment is safe for most household items and supplies immediate results, decreasing the requirement for chemical applications. Post-treatment tracking guarantees complete elimination and avoids reinfestation.
